Compare Redwood City to Yorba Linda

This post compares Redwood City, California to Yorba Linda,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Redwood City (city) Yorba Linda (city)
Population 84,368 67,740
Income (median) $70,131 $82,372
Home Value (median) $1,016,700 $792,700
White 60% 73%
Black 2% 1%
Asian 14% 18%
With Kids 32% 38%
Age (median) 37 43
Rentals 49% 17%
